Barcelona Forward Rashford Misses Open Goal in Preseason Match vs Como
Marcus Rashford, on loan to Barcelona from Manchester United, had a mixed performance in Barcelona’s 5-0 preseason win over Como, highlighted by a notable missed opportunity that left teammates and fans stunned. Despite providing an assist for Raphinha and contributing to the team's dominant play, Rashford famously missed an open goal after rounding the goalkeeper, an error that overshadowed the otherwise comfortable victory. The miss occurred during the Joan Gamper Trophy, Barcelona’s final preseason match before the 2025/26 campaign, and sparked widespread reactions on social media. Barcelona’s commanding win included multiple goals from Fermin Lopez, Raphinha, and teenage sensation Lamine Yamal, who scored twice. Rashford was substituted at halftime, with the club still managing his registration issues due to salary cap constraints ahead of the La Liga season opener against Mallorca. His performances thus far have raised questions about his sharpness as he looks to establish himself in Barcelona’s new attacking setup under coach Hansi Flick.
